Commit graph

  • 49f3a0d78e
    Merge 39c0b1478b into 545a23734e #11046 Ilya Grigoriev 2025-01-25 20:03:55 +0100
  • f087d29946
    Merge 7e9e87e942 into 545a23734e #11080 kerty0 2025-01-25 20:03:55 +0100
  • 545a23734e Remove some ffi wrappers master Fabian Boehm 2025-01-24 16:24:08 +0100
  • d69a9296a6 completions/llm: Complete model alias target Mahmoud Al-Qudsi 2025-01-25 12:50:03 -0600
  • 12d19e6ac1
    Merge 361e6aa292 into 3fdd2d3fc2 #10722 Emily Grace Seville 2025-01-24 12:33:57 +0300
  • 4b11f93441
    Merge 3525b20c03 into 3fdd2d3fc2 #10729 Emily Grace Seville 2025-01-24 12:33:57 +0300
  • 6c0be2b1d6
    Merge 957e96645d into 3fdd2d3fc2 #10757 Emily Grace Seville 2025-01-24 12:33:57 +0300
  • d56742262a
    Merge 1dafc5501b into 3fdd2d3fc2 #10804 Emily Grace Seville 2025-01-24 12:33:57 +0300
  • a368e79c24
    Merge 5a37adb3da into 3fdd2d3fc2 #10855 Ilya Grigoriev 2025-01-24 12:33:57 +0300
  • 591f37f69d
    Merge 401ca13f20 into 3fdd2d3fc2 #10927 DevAtDawn 2025-01-24 12:33:57 +0300
  • 0f7debed16
    Merge 6f5923bda3 into 3fdd2d3fc2 #10937 Integral 2025-01-24 12:33:57 +0300
  • e92f4ea345
    Merge 1af5d458c2 into 3fdd2d3fc2 #11020 Fabian Boehm 2025-01-24 12:33:57 +0300
  • 5b484f504d
    Merge 0fefd8a365 into 3fdd2d3fc2 #11053 idealseal 2025-01-24 12:33:57 +0300
  • cab03a6160
    Merge e5e8670bcb into 3fdd2d3fc2 #10449 Johannes Altmanninger 2025-01-24 12:33:56 +0300
  • 0dd4b6acda
    Merge d38a1bcaff into 3fdd2d3fc2 #11074 Ilya Grigoriev 2025-01-24 06:47:14 +0000
  • d38a1bcaff completions/tmux: some windows and panes boolean flag completions #11074 Ilya Grigoriev 2025-01-19 19:27:20 -0800
  • f29f3938a5
    Merge 14d9cac89c into 3fdd2d3fc2 #10993 kekeimiku 2025-01-23 18:43:34 -0500
  • 12c3aad463
    Merge 07b2f93b9c into 3fdd2d3fc2 #11086 Ilya Grigoriev 2025-01-23 15:14:46 -0800
  • e805851e28
    Merge bca86b048a into 3fdd2d3fc2 #11071 ccoVeille 2025-01-23 14:41:12 -0800
  • 6fe81d1661
    Merge deae481d51 into 3fdd2d3fc2 #11072 Max Jacobson 2025-01-23 14:40:31 -0800
  • 3d5b6303a2
    Merge 2236ed994a into 3fdd2d3fc2 #11069 ccoVeille 2025-01-23 22:30:19 +0200
  • 471b6a4a8c
    Merge ce7c116b57 into 3fdd2d3fc2 #11063 Farhood 2025-01-23 20:14:03 +0100
  • ada52aabc2
    Merge 3a0c06b7ad into 3fdd2d3fc2 #11073 Ilya Grigoriev 2025-01-24 02:47:24 +0800
  • 7e9e87e942 Rename some methods of ReaderHistorySearch to improve clarity #11080 kerty 2025-01-23 14:25:23 +0300
  • 3d9a35e1c0
    Merge 9ab6089b03 into 3fdd2d3fc2 #10759 Kemel Zaidan 2025-01-24 00:14:29 +0800
  • 822ef4d687
    Merge a23f7ff593 into 3fdd2d3fc2 #11068 ccoVeille 2025-01-24 00:14:29 +0800
  • 3fdd2d3fc2 Small refactor of HighlightSpec kerty 2025-01-22 22:54:50 +0300
  • db546da3ca Made undo/redo not update autosuggestion if failed kerty 2025-01-22 22:35:24 +0300
  • 6a9f1b925d Make flash highlight autosuggestion on failed deletion kerty 2025-01-22 22:34:38 +0300
  • bffbf0cd57 Make flash highlight relevant commandline section kerty 2025-01-21 21:12:45 +0300
  • b5c869d5e7 Make parse_util_token_extent return its output instead of mutating input. kerty 2025-01-21 16:16:47 +0300
  • 4994000a27 Small refactor of Reader::flash kerty 2025-01-22 23:18:14 +0300
  • d5fdcc96c8 Fix typos in .rst files ccoVeille 2025-01-19 21:32:26 +0100
  • 07b2f93b9c language.rst: make description of features more consistent (minor) #11086 Ilya Grigoriev 2025-01-22 23:18:39 -0800
  • aee729bd44 Update changelog for cancel-commandline Johannes Altmanninger 2025-01-21 22:25:04 +0100
  • 063ecd354d
    Merge 91274a6802 into 92582d5b1f #11056 Fabian Boehm 2025-01-23 09:03:46 +0800
  • 92582d5b1f Back out "Escape : and = in file completions" Integration_4.0.0 Johannes Altmanninger 2025-01-10 21:18:10 +0100
  • 8eb5e36aa6 Swap code blocks for completing separator suffix resp. whole token Johannes Altmanninger 2025-01-11 12:07:19 +0100
  • fd3ed7cfa5 functions/__fish_cancel_commandline: Follow rename of bind function Fabian Boehm 2025-01-22 17:43:59 +0100
  • 4e13ce33c5 functions/__fish_cancel_commandline: Follow rename of bind function Fabian Boehm 2025-01-22 17:43:59 +0100
  • 3a0c06b7ad completions/tmux: basic window argument completions #11073 Ilya Grigoriev 2025-01-21 23:24:17 -0800
  • eab9e647f4 checks/tmux-history-pager: Disable on CI in general Fabian Boehm 2025-01-21 17:31:45 +0100
  • e67819f532 Wrap libc::umask Fabian Boehm 2025-01-19 21:09:28 +0100
  • 29cddabfe4 Fix regression causing fish_key_reader to not request kitty flags Johannes Altmanninger 2025-01-21 14:07:07 +0100
  • 4c9dfcc5d7 CHANGELOG: work on 4.0.0 David Adam 2025-01-21 00:06:40 +0800
  • 945a535570 fish_default_key_bindings: remove duplicate ctrl-k binding David Adam 2025-01-16 21:05:12 +0800
  • 7d24bd3218 completions/tmux: add ability to complete buffer names and commands Ilya Grigoriev 2025-01-19 19:22:23 -0800
  • 5a37adb3da completions/tmux: complete commands inside tmux lscm #10855 Ilya Grigoriev 2024-11-18 16:03:35 -0800
  • 7b289401fa completions/tmux: complete all flags when tmux lscm is available Ilya Grigoriev 2024-11-18 14:12:43 -0800
  • 7043dbd3da completions/tmux: complete all subcommands when tmux lscm works Ilya Grigoriev 2024-11-17 23:40:00 -0800
  • deae481d51
    Fix formatting of abbr example #11072 Max Jacobson 2025-01-19 19:24:10 -0500
  • bca86b048a
    Fix typo in tests #11071 ccoVeille 2025-01-19 21:35:55 +0100
  • 76a2968979
    Fix typo in code ccoVeille 2025-01-19 21:35:45 +0100
  • 30811263b5
    Fix typos in comments ccoVeille 2025-01-19 21:34:42 +0100
  • 291d3f2777
    Fix typos in .rst files #11070 ccoVeille 2025-01-19 21:32:26 +0100
  • 2236ed994a
    Fix typos in completions scripts #11069 ccoVeille 2025-01-19 21:14:10 +0100
  • a23f7ff593
    Fix completion for celsius flag in acpi(1) #11068 ccoVeille 2025-01-19 20:55:04 +0100
  • 4024d82412 Fix double expansion of tokenized command line Johannes Altmanninger 2025-01-19 17:13:05 +0100
  • 8208a12a76 Back out "Support help argument in "{ -h"" Johannes Altmanninger 2025-01-19 18:51:06 +0100
  • d3c37de753 Back out "Always treat brace at command start as compound statement" Johannes Altmanninger 2025-01-19 18:50:52 +0100
  • a7fdd8d002 Back out "Back out "Remove awkward assert"" Johannes Altmanninger 2025-01-19 18:50:34 +0100
  • 92bd366c1b Back out "Allow if/then/fi, while/do/done and for/do/done" Johannes Altmanninger 2025-01-19 18:49:05 +0100
  • 5b0622cf00 Disable tmux-history-pager test on ASAN Fabian Boehm 2025-01-19 18:54:56 +0100
  • 98a96f5b58 Revert "Swap alt-{left,right,backspace,delete} with ctrl-* on macOS" Fabian Boehm 2025-01-19 18:52:10 +0100
  • 0494b1b608 tests/checks/exec: Match entire env line Fabian Boehm 2025-01-19 18:47:28 +0100
  • 494bdfa013 Revert accidentally pushed fork Fabian Boehm 2025-01-19 18:34:42 +0100
  • 97db461e7f README for this fork Johannes Altmanninger 2024-11-17 08:11:41 +0100
  • 45a2017580 Allow foo=bar global variable assignments Johannes Altmanninger 2024-11-21 11:02:34 +0100
  • 0199583435 Interpret () in command position as subshell Johannes Altmanninger 2024-11-21 23:33:13 +0100
  • 4a71ee1288 Allow special variables $?,$$,$@,$# Johannes Altmanninger 2024-11-22 00:00:42 +0100
  • 4b99fe2288 Allow $() in command position Johannes Altmanninger 2024-11-21 23:33:13 +0100
  • b1213f1385 Turn off full LTO Johannes Altmanninger 2024-11-19 22:10:44 +0100
  • f43abc42f9 Back out "bind: Remove "c-" and "a-" shortcut notation" Johannes Altmanninger 2024-11-16 13:10:57 +0100
  • 485201ba2e Un-hide documentation of non-fish shell builtins Johannes Altmanninger 2024-11-17 07:27:50 +0100
  • e32572e4e6 Allow if/then/fi, while/do/done and for/do/done Johannes Altmanninger 2024-11-17 09:02:20 +0100
  • ebdc3a0393 Swap alt-{left,right,backspace,delete} with ctrl-* on macOS Johannes Altmanninger 2025-01-06 21:09:41 +0100
  • e0c6384ed3 Back out "Remove awkward assert" Johannes Altmanninger 2025-01-16 23:11:09 +0100
  • 98750e1ae5 Always treat brace at command start as compound statement Johannes Altmanninger 2025-01-14 23:33:39 +0100
  • efce176ceb Support help argument in "{ -h" Johannes Altmanninger 2025-01-13 06:25:35 +0100
  • f26ebac8dd Fix macOS quotation issue in test tmux-multiline-prompt.fish kerty 2025-01-19 00:37:37 +0300
  • 4ce8037e73 Fix grep regex in test locale-numeric.fish kerty 2025-01-19 00:36:13 +0300
  • 8116e80140 Add test for history pager kerty 2025-01-19 00:05:15 +0300
  • 3436836b94 Add automatic history search page change when deleting last element on last page kerty 2025-01-11 23:38:59 +0300
  • 4e965cba47 Separate SelectionMotion from HistoryPagerInvocation kerty 2025-01-15 20:19:57 +0300
  • 9b14408b1b Make history search banner display start and end indexes kerty 2025-01-11 22:19:32 +0300
  • f28e43717b Fix history pager inconsistent ordering and skipping 13th elements kerty 2025-01-11 20:26:52 +0300
  • 059e7424c1 Fix refreshing from deletion after forward search kerty 2025-01-11 21:07:33 +0300
  • 6b5ad163d3 Fix double expansion of tokenized command line Johannes Altmanninger 2025-01-19 17:13:05 +0100
  • 7ad47c34e8 Fix regression causing scrollback-push to not clear text below cursor Johannes Altmanninger 2025-01-19 13:28:12 +0100
  • 2dccba4f65 Fix double expansion of tokenized command line #11067 Johannes Altmanninger 2025-01-19 17:13:05 +0100
  • a328fd995b Clarify __fish_complete_subcommand comment Ilya Grigoriev 2025-01-17 23:31:12 -0800
  • bcc69da569 tmux completions: complete shell commands Ilya Grigoriev 2025-01-16 15:20:17 -0800
  • dfa77e6c19 completions/git: show custom aliases for --pretty option Dmitry Gerasimov 2025-01-18 15:05:14 +0100
  • 9752b83e65 completions/git: update supported git format options Dmitry Gerasimov 2025-01-18 14:08:04 +0100
  • 4208798585 completions: add unbuffer completions Ilya Grigoriev 2025-01-16 20:38:42 -0800
  • 8a6ba7fc4c Silence unused_imports on newer compilers Mahmoud Al-Qudsi 2025-01-18 17:10:51 -0600
  • 4e80276970 Fix macOS quotation issue in test tmux-multiline-prompt.fish #11021 kerty 2025-01-19 00:37:37 +0300
  • a263a1ff0b Fix grep regex in test locale-numeric.fish kerty 2025-01-19 00:36:13 +0300
  • 7d08151d56 Add test for history pager kerty 2025-01-19 00:05:15 +0300
  • 5e2e30033f Add automatic history search page change when deleting last element on last page kerty 2025-01-11 23:38:59 +0300